Web Publishing Solution for Heat Maps
Heat Map Explorer Web Viewer Edition is a web publishing
solution for heat maps created in
Heat Map Explorer Standard or Professional Edition.
The published heat map is fully interactive with a similar interface to the
desktop editions. It offers web users full capabilities to
view and explore information, to perform grouping, filtering,
and searching, to modify color schemes, and to drill down into
sub-groups and individual records.

Features
Web Viewer Edition Features
- Publish any heat map developed in Heat Map Explorer Standard or Professional
Edition
- Share interactive heat maps with others through a
standard web interface - no need to install software for every
report user
Common Heat Map Features
- Group data dynamically to see details and patterns in context
- Search and filter interactively on text and data characteristics
- Use any of dozens of color schemes
- Use multiple layout types to view data in different ways
- Drill down with details
- Share interactive heat maps with others

System Requirements
End-User Requirements
- Any Microsoft Windows, Macintosh, or a Unix-based operating system
- Microsoft Internet Explorer 5.0 or later, or Firefox 1.0 or later
- Sun Java Plug-in 1.4 or later
Server Requirements (ASP.Net Version)
- Microsoft Windows Server 2000 or later
- Internet Information Server 6.0 or later
- Microsoft .NET Framework 2.0 or later
- 500 MHz Pentium 3 or equivalent processor (1 GHz recommended)
- 512 MB RAM
- 2 MB free disk space for installation
Server Requirements (J2EE Version)
- J2EE servlet container compliant with Java Servlet Specification 2.3 or higher
- Java J2EE 1.4 or higher
- 500 MHz Pentium 3 or equivalent processor (1 GHz recommended)
- 512 MB RAM
- 8 MB free disk space for installation
